This zine talks about the ways that ABC was alienating to its neighbors and neighborhood and that the art and expression presented there talked more to issues affecting the burgeois rather than the working class people of the neighborhood. The rest of the stories discuss successes and failtures of incorporating different kinds of performance art into ABC's schedule as well as dogs puking, people walking onstage with guns, chicken suits, and a woman pissing in a vase.
